What is the meaning of the name Farid?

The name Farid is primarily a male name of Arabic origin that means Precious And Unique.

The name Farid is of Arabic origin and is a masculine given name. The meaning of Farid is “unique,” “incomparable,” or “singular.” It is derived from the Arabic word “فريد” (farid), which signifies singularity or uniqueness.

Farid is a name that conveys qualities of being one of a kind and incomparable. It signifies someone who stands out and is unique in their characteristics or qualities. The name Farid is relatively common in Arabic-speaking communities and among individuals of Arabic descent. It carries a sense of distinction and individuality.

Different Spellings of the name Farid:

The name Farid is relatively consistent in its spelling, especially in Arabic. However, variations in spelling can occur due to phonetic interpretations or adaptations to different languages and regions. Some possible spellings and variations of Farid include:

1. Farid (the most common and widely recognized spelling in Arabic)
2. Fareed (an alternate spelling)
3. Faried (another variation)
4. Faread (another variant)

While these variations exist, the most common and traditional spelling is “Farid,” especially in Arabic-speaking cultures.

How to write the name Farid in Japanese?

Transcribing the name “Farid” into Japanese can be done using Katakana, a script commonly used for foreign words and names. In Katakana, “Farid” would be written as:

ファリド

This is pronounced as “Farido” and represents an approximation of the sound of “Farid” in English, adapted to the phonetic system of the Japanese language. However, it’s important to note that “Farid” is not a common personal name in Japanese culture, so its use in Japanese would be unconventional.
